History for February 10
- 1763 - The Treaty of Paris ended the French and Indian War. In the treaty France ceded Canada to England.
- 1863 - In New York City, two of the world’s most famous midgets, General Tom Thumb and Lavinia Warren were married.
- 1863 - In Virginia, the first fire extinguisher patent was issued to Alanson Crane.
- 1933 - The singing telegram was introduced by the Postal Telegraph Company of New York City.
- 1967 - The 25th Amendment to the U.S. Constitution was ratified. The amendment required the appointment of a vice-president when that office became vacant and instituted new measures in the event of presidential disability.
